Undercounter Microwave Drawers

As the latest trend in kitchen design, microwave drawers offer more flexibility than traditional countertop models or over-the-range models. They can be incorporated into lower cabinets beneath countertops, on top of a kitchen island or above a wall oven for seamless design. They can be opened instead of swinging on hinges making it easier for chefs who are left-handed to reach them.

These sleek appliances can be a great choice for homeowners who want to reduce the size of their counters, increase storage in their kitchens or keep them visually open. Although they are more expensive than traditional microwaves, built in microwave 25 litre many homeowners believe that the superior design and function are worth the extra expense.

Contrary to a conventional countertop or over-the-range model microwave drawers are flat and are flush with your cabinetry. This makes them a good option for a kitchen remodel that is custom. Installing a microwave in an existing kitchen is feasible. If you're doing a full kitchen renovation, you should select a microwave drawer in the planning phase and have it installed in the same time the new cabinets and other appliances are being installed.

Microwave drawers are also great for those who have trouble reaching a standard countertop or over-the-range microwave. They feature a low, sleek front that can be opened and closed with a push of a button. They're also more convenient for people who are short or with back issues who have difficulty lifting heavy dishes into a microwave that is over the range.

Some of the disadvantages to a microwave drawer include the price that is much higher than a traditional countertop microwave or an over-the-range model, and the fact that they aren't able to permit convection cooking. They also don't have a turntable, which can be a hassle for those who like to stir their food as it cooks or need to fit large oblong containers that won't fit on the microwave plate.

Finally, a microwave drawer isn't as easy to clean like a countertop or an over-the-range microwave since there aren't exposed scratching surfaces. To maintain its clean appearance it is best to wipe the microwave drawer clean using a damp rag.

Convection Cooking

cookology-im17lbk-built-in-microwave-in-black-integrated-frame-trim-kit-4980-small.jpgConvection cooking can help your food cook faster and more evenly. Convection utilizes an exhaust system and a fan to circulate hot oven air over your food, eliminating the hot spots and uneven heating that can happen when you use a regular oven. Convection makes it less necessary to changing or rotating your food when baking.

Microwaves with a convection setting are perfect for baking or roasting vegetables, as well as making casseroles. By circulating hot air, they make food to brown and crisp up more quickly. They can also be used to bake and prepare cakes. There are a variety of ways to use microwaves that have a convection feature. It's worth knowing how to make the most of this beneficial feature.

It may seem counterintuitive but you need to check your food more often when using the convection microwave. The food cooks faster in convection microwaves than in an oven. It is crucial to remove the food from the microwave after it has been cooked. It is recommended to check your food about two-thirds or three-quarters of the way through the recommended cooking time. It is also helpful to use bakeware with lower sides, like baking sheets and shallow pans, so that the air can circulate freely.

Space Saving

A double oven allows you to cook a variety of meals simultaneously. This will save you time in the kitchen which allows you to put food on the table quicker. It also allows you to organize dinner parties for friends and family without having to wait for a dish to be finished before starting the next. This is especially beneficial for families with busy children.

When selecting a double oven, take into consideration the overall dimensions and internal capacity of each oven compartment. Also, you should carefully consider your cooking needs and household size to ensure this appliance is not oversized. Also, you'll want to be careful not to select the model that is too high for your space. A higher height could limit access to the area and increase the likelihood of injury.

There are two types of double ovens: wall-mounted or range-style. Both have advantages however the best one will depend on the design of your kitchen and your personal preferences in design. For instance an oven that is mounted on the wall can be mounted at an appropriate height, while a range-style model can be incorporated into your kitchen cabinetry to create a an elegant and seamless look.
